Beyond Environmental Claims in Small Business Marketing

Social Justice & Human Dignity

Brands like Ben & Jerry’s don’t just donate to causes — they integrate activism into their supply chains, creating opportunities in underserved communities while advocating for real policy change.

Community Empowerment

REI’s “Path Ahead Ventures” invests $30 million in diverse outdoor entrepreneurs, showing the best ways to market a business by building genuine connections with local communities.

Economic Fairness

Everlane’s radical transparency — showing true costs and factory conditions — has become a defining feature of their identity, proving that honesty is a powerful marketing tool.

The Business Case for Purpose-Driven Marketing for Small Business

Building the Loyalty Engine

Purpose creates emotional connections that purely transactional relationships can’t match. TOMS’ “buy one, give one” model is a perfect example of values-driven loyalty.

Employee Engagement Gains from Purpose-Driven Marketing for Small Business

Companies with a clear mission experience higher employee engagement, which boosts customer experience and retention. Salesforce’s “1-1-1” philanthropic model is a standout example.


Technology Enablers in Purpose-Driven Marketing for Small Business

Transparent Supply Chains That Build Trust

Starbucks uses blockchain to let customers trace coffee from bean to cup, verifying ethical sourcing.
